Iran war dampens sentiment, but future DI may reflect hopes for end to war

We expect the June 2026 BoJ Tankan, scheduled for release on 1 July, toChief Economist:

show a mixed picture in the business conditions DI for large manufacturersShunsuke Kobayashi

and a deterioration for large non-manufacturers compared to the previous+81 3 6202 8222

shunsuke.kobayashi@mizuho-sc.com survey. The survey was sent out on 28 May and the deadline for response was

11 June. As of the response cutoff date, higher resource prices and supply

Economist: constraints from the escalating conflict in the Middle East were likely weighing

Soichiro Hirose on sentiment. However, the survey continues to collect responses until just+81 3 6202 8293 before release, so some responses may reflect expectations for an end to thesoichiro.hirose@mizuho-sc.com

US-Iran war (see Figure 1).

We forecast that large-enterprise capex plans for both FY25 and FY26 will

track the usual seasonal pattern. Although we expect FY25 capex plans to

be revised down, we still look for solid levels of spending (see Figure 2). In

contrast, we expect FY26 capex plans to be revised upward.

Current business conditions DI: Forecasting deterioration for both

manufacturers and non-manufacturers

We forecast the current business conditions DI at +15 for large manufacturers,

down 2pt from the +17 reading in the March survey, and at +35 for large non-

manufacturers, down 1pt from +36 in March (see Figure 1 and Figures 3–4).
